The European Council for Nuclear Research (CERN) is a premier research institution specializing in particle physics, where groundbreaking experiments probe the fundamental nature of matter and the universe. CERN’s innovative experiments, including the Large Hadron Collider, push the boundaries of scientific knowledge and technological development. By fostering international collaboration, CERN serves as a global hub for advancing fundamental science and exploring the universe’s deepest mysteries.
